#eeb55e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eeb55e is composed of 93.3% red, 71%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.9% magenta, 60.5%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 36.3 degrees, a saturation of 80.9% and a lightness of 65.1%. #eeb55e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ffbc with #dd6b00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#eeb55e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#eeb55e has RGB values of R:238, G:181,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.61,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15643998.
